Understanding Online Casino Licensing and Regulation

One of the most critical aspects of choosing an online casino is verifying its licensing and regulatory status. A legitimate online casino will be licensed by a reputable regulatory body, such as the Malta Gaming Authority, the UK Gambling Commission, or the Curacao eGaming. These bodies impose strict standards and regulations that casinos must adhere to, ensuring fair play, secure transactions, and responsible gaming practices. Without proper licensing, players have little recourse in case of disputes or fraudulent activity. It demonstrates a commitment to player protection and operational integrity.

The Importance of Third-Party Audits

Beyond licensing, look for casinos that undergo independent audits by organizations like eCOGRA or iTech Labs. These audits verify the fairness of the casino’s games, ensuring that the Random Number Generators (RNGs) are functioning correctly and producing unbiased results. These third-party evaluations provide an extra layer of assurance that the games are not rigged and offer players a genuine chance of winning. The results of these audits are typically published on the casino’s website, and players should review them carefully before depositing any funds. A lack of transparency in this area should raise concerns.

Regulatory BodyJurisdictionKey Responsibilities
Malta Gaming Authority Malta Licensing, regulation, and enforcement of gaming operations.
UK Gambling Commission United Kingdom Regulation of all forms of gambling, including online casinos.
Curacao eGaming Curacao Licensing and regulation of online gambling operators.

Understanding the nuances of different regulatory bodies is also essential. Some jurisdictions have more stringent requirements than others, and this can impact the level of player protection offered. For example, the UK Gambling Commission is known for its robust regulations and strict enforcement, while other jurisdictions may have a more lenient approach. Doing your research on the licensing body is just as important as verifying the license itself.

Evaluating Casino Security Measures

Protecting your personal and financial information is paramount when gambling online. A reputable casino will employ state-of-the-art security measures to safeguard your data. This includes using Secure Socket Layer (SSL) encryption to protect all data transmitted between your computer and the casino’s servers. SSL ensures that your information is scrambled and unreadable to unauthorized parties. Look for the padlock icon in your browser’s address bar, which indicates that the website is using SSL encryption. Beyond SSL, casinos should also employ firewalls, intrusion detection systems, and other security protocols to prevent unauthorized access to their systems.

Secure Payment Methods and Data Protection

The payment methods offered by a casino are another indication of its security standards. Reputable casinos will offer a variety of secure payment options, such as credit cards, debit cards, e-wallets (like P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ller), and bank transfers. They should also have robust fraud prevention measures in place to detect and prevent fraudulent transactions. Moreover, a trustworthy casino will have a clear and comprehensive privacy policy outlining how your personal information is collected, used, and protected. Reviewing this policy is crucial to understanding your rights and how your data is handled.

  • SSL Encryption: Protects data transmission.
  • Firewalls: Prevent unauthorized access.
  • Secure Payment Gateways: Ensure safe transactions.
  • Two-Factor Authentication: Adds an extra layer of security.

Furthermore, investigate the casino’s history regarding security breaches. While no system is entirely immune to attacks, a casino with a clean track record and a demonstrated commitment to security is a more trustworthy option. Look for independent security reviews and certifications to further validate their security claims. It's a core element of responsible gaming.

Assessing Game Selection and Software Providers

A diverse and high-quality game selection is a key indicator of a good online casino. Players should have access to a wide range of games, including slots, table games (such as blackjack, roulette, and baccarat), video poker, and live dealer games. The games should be provided by reputable software providers known for their fairness, innovation, and engaging gameplay. Some of the leading software providers in the industry include Microgaming, NetEnt, Playtech, Evolution Gaming, and Pragmatic Play. These companies invest heavily in research and development to create cutting-edge games with stunning graphics, immersive sound effects, and innovative features.

The Role of Random Number Generators (RNGs)

The fairness of online casino games relies heavily on the integrity of the Random Number Generators (RNGs). RNGs are algorithms that produce random sequences of numbers, ensuring that the outcome of each game is unpredictable and unbiased. Reputable software providers use certified RNGs that are regularly tested and audited by independent third-party organizations. This certification verifies that the RNGs are functioning correctly and producing truly random results. Without a certified RNG, the games may be rigged or manipulated, giving the casino an unfair advantage. Players should always choose casinos that use games from certified RNG providers.

  1. Microgaming: Known for progressive jackpot slots.
  2. NetEnt: Renowned for innovative and visually stunning games.
  3. Playtech: Offers a wide range of games, including branded titles.
  4. Evolution Gaming: Leading provider of live dealer games.
  5. Pragmatic Play: Delivers popular slots and table games.

Beyond the sheer number of games, consider the variety within each category. Does the casino offer different variations of roulette or blackjack? Are there enough slot games with diverse themes and features? A well-rounded game selection caters to a wider range of player preferences and enhances the overall gaming experience. It is also advisable to check which games contribute to bonus wagering requirements as this can affect the actual value of any promotional offers.

Understanding Bonus Structures and Wagering Requirements

Online casinos often offer a variety of bonuses and promotions to attract new players and reward existing ones. These bonuses can include welcome bonuses, deposit bonuses, free spins, and loyalty programs. While bonuses can be a great way to boost your bankroll, it’s crucial to understand the terms and conditions associated with them. Specifically, pay close attention to the wagering requirements, which specify how many times you must wager the bonus amount before you can withdraw any winnings. High wagering requirements can make it difficult to actually cash out your bonus funds.

For example, a bonus with a 50x wagering requirement means you must wager 50 times the bonus amount before you can withdraw any winnings. Other important terms and conditions to consider include game restrictions (some games may not contribute to the wagering requirement), maximum bet limits, and expiration dates. Always read the fine print before accepting a bonus to ensure you fully understand the rules and can realistically meet the wagering requirements. Don’t assume!

The Importance of Customer Support

Reliable and responsive customer support is essential for a positive online gaming experience. A good casino will offer multiple channels for customer support, such as live chat, email, and phone support. Live chat is generally the most convenient option as it provides instant assistance. The support team should be knowledgeable, friendly, and able to resolve issues quickly and efficiently. Before signing up for an online casino, test out their customer support by asking a few questions to gauge their responsiveness and helpfulness. The availability of support in your preferred language is also a significant benefit.

Look for casinos that offer 24/7 customer support, ensuring that assistance is available whenever you need it. A comprehensive FAQ section can also be a valuable resource for finding answers to common questions. The quality of customer support is often a direct reflection of the casino’s overall commitment to player satisfaction. Neglecting customer care typically suggests underlying issues within the operation.

Beyond the Basics: Responsible Gaming and Self-Exclusion

Online gaming can be a fun and entertaining pastime, but it’s important to gamble responsibly. Set a budget for your gaming activities and stick to it, and never gamble more than you can afford to lose. Be aware of the signs of problem gambling, such as chasing losses, spending excessive amounts of time gambling, or neglecting other important aspects of your life. Reputable online casinos will offer a range of tools and resources to help players gamble responsibly, including deposit limits, loss limits, and self-exclusion options. Self-exclusion allows you to voluntarily ban yourself from the casino for a specified period of time.

These resources demonstrate a commitment to player welfare and align with the industry's growing awareness of responsible gaming practices. If you or someone you know is struggling with problem gambling, seek help from a qualified professional. Don’t hesitate to reach out to organizations dedicated to providing support and guidance to individuals affected by gambling addiction. Remember that gaming should be viewed as entertainment, and it’s crucial to maintain a healthy and balanced relationship with it.
